I don't think there are any tours for the zoo. It's not that big. They have certain "talks" during the day where the zookeepr showcases the animals (check out the website for times).

There are a number of buses that take you from central Auckland (if that's where you're leaving from) along the Great North Road and a single fare is I think 4 NZ dollars. They take about 15-20 minutes and can drop you off at the corner of Motions Road. From there it's a five-minute walk.
